#026df5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#026df5 is composed of 0.8% red, 42.7%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 213.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#026df5 color hex could be obtained by blending #04daff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#026df5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#026df5 has RGB values of R:2, G:109,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 159221.

Shades and Tints of #026df5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00050c is the darkest color, while #f7fbff is the lightest one.
